GARDNER DENVER, INC. COMPLETES ACQUISITION OF SYLTONE PLC:
Receives Acceptances in Excess of 96% of Shares Outstanding

QUINCY, IL, (January 5, 2004) – Gardner Denver, Inc. (NYSE:GDI) has declared its previously announced cash offer of 185 pence per share for the outstanding shares of Syltone plc to be wholly unconditional, effectively completing this acquisition. Holders of more than 96% of the outstanding shares of Syltone plc capital have accepted the offer either in cash or by electing to receive their consideration in the form of loan notes. Since the level of acceptances exceeds the 90% threshold, Gardner Denver will exercise its right to compulsorily acquire all remaining outstanding Syltone shares. The acquisition will be funded from Gardner Denver’s existing cash resources and committed credit facilities.

Gardner Denver, with 2002 revenues of $418 million, is a leading manufacturer of reciprocating, rotary and vane compressors and blowers for various industrial applications and pumps used in the petroleum and industrial markets.
